About Edge Learning
Edge Learning is a charter elementary school located in Akron, Ohio. Serving kindergarten through fifth grade, Edge Learning has an enrollment of 241 students and maintains a student-to-teacher ratio of 14.2:1 with 17 full-time equivalent teachers. The school's MySchoolScout rating stands at 4.2 out of 10, reflecting its state ranking as the 2674th best out of 3468 schools in Ohio.
Academically, Edge Learning has room for improvement, with an ELA/Reading proficiency rate of 34% and a Math proficiency rate of 26%. While academic performance is currently below average, the school focuses on fostering student development and growth. Located in a mid-size city setting, Edge Learning provides a supportive environment for its diverse community of learners.

Performance Trends
Math proficiency has declined from 32% (2019) to 12% (2021). Reading/ELA proficiency has declined from 37% (2019) to 17% (2021).

Community Profile
The community surrounding Edge Learning has a median household income of $35,946. It is an area where 33%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her. The median home value in the area is $70,500, with a median rent of $958/month. The area has a poverty rate of 41.3%, indicating some economic challenges in the community. Residents enjoy a short average commute of 18 minutes. Source: U.S. Census ACS 2022 5-Year Estimates.
